// The client demonstrates how to use the credential reloading feature in
// advancedtls to make a mTLS connection to the server.
package main
import (
"context"
"flag"
"log"
"time"
"google.golang.org/grpc"
"google.golang.org/grpc/credentials/tls/certprovider/pemfile"
pb "google.golang.org/grpc/examples/helloworld/helloworld"
"google.golang.org/grpc/security/advancedtls"
"google.golang.org/grpc/security/advancedtls/testdata"
)
var address = "localhost:50051"
const (
// Default timeout for normal connections.
defaultTimeout = 2 * time.Second
// Intervals that set to monitor the credential updates.
credRefreshingInterval = 500 * time.Millisecond
)
func main() {
tmpKeyFile := flag.String("key", "", "temporary key file path")
tmpCertFile := flag.String("cert", "", "temporary cert file path")
flag.Parse()
if tmpKeyFile == nil || *tmpKeyFile == "" {
log.Fatalf("tmpKeyFile is nil or empty.")
}
if tmpCertFile == nil || *tmpCertFile == "" {
log.Fatalf("tmpCertFile is nil or empty.")
}
// Initialize credential struct using reloading API.
identityOptions := pemfile.Options{
CertFile: *tmpCertFile,
KeyFile: *tmpKeyFile,
RefreshDuration: credRefreshingInterval,
}
identityProvider, err := pemfile.NewProvider(identityOptions)
if err != nil {
log.Fatalf("pemfile.NewProvider(%v) failed: %v", identityOptions, err)
}
rootOptions := pemfile.Options{
RootFile: testdata.Path("client_trust_cert_1.pem"),
RefreshDuration: credRefreshingInterval,
}
rootProvider, err := pemfile.NewProvider(rootOptions)
if err != nil {
log.Fatalf("pemfile.NewProvider(%v) failed: %v", rootOptions, err)
}
options := &advancedtls.Options{
IdentityOptions: advancedtls.IdentityCertificateOptions{
IdentityProvider: identityProvider,
},
AdditionalPeerVerification: func(*advancedtls.HandshakeVerificationInfo) (*advancedtls.PostHandshakeVerificationResults, error) {
return &advancedtls.PostHandshakeVerificationResults{}, nil
},
RootOptions: advancedtls.RootCertificateOptions{
RootProvider: rootProvider,
},
VerificationType: advancedtls.CertVerification,
}
clientTLSCreds, err := advancedtls.NewClientCreds(options)
if err != nil {
log.Fatalf("advancedtls.NewClientCreds(%v) failed: %v", options, err)
}
// Make a connection using the credentials.
conn, err := grpc.NewClient(address, grpc.WithTransportCredentials(clientTLSCreds))
if err != nil {
log.Fatalf("grpc.NewClient to %s failed: %v", address, err)
}
client := pb.NewGreeterClient(conn)
// Send the requests every 0.5s. The credential is expected to be changed in
// the bash script. We don't cancel the context nor call conn.Close() here,
// since the bash script is expected to close the client goroutine.
for {
ctx, cancel := context.WithTimeout(context.Background(), defaultTimeout)
_, err = client.SayHello(ctx, &pb.HelloRequest{Name: "gRPC"}, grpc.WaitForReady(true))
if err != nil {
log.Fatalf("client.SayHello failed: %v", err)
}
cancel()
time.Sleep(500 * time.Millisecond)
}
}
